Why Skilled Trades are in High Demand

Factor Description Impact
Aging Workforce Many experienced tradespeople are nearing retirement, creating vacancies. High demand for new entrants and skilled replacements.
Infrastructure Projects Ongoing investment in construction, transport, and energy. Continuous need for construction skilled trades and related roles.
Technological Advancements New technologies require specialised skills for installation, maintenance, and repair. Demand for tradespeople who can adapt and learn new techniques.
Skills Gap Insufficient numbers of individuals entering trades to meet current demand. Trades that are in demand offer strong career prospects and good pay.
Economic Resilience Trades are less susceptible to economic downturns due to essential services. Stable employment opportunities for skilled labor.

Millwrights (Industrial Mechanic)

millwright is a highly specialised and versatile industrial mechanic, often considered one of the best skilled trades to pursue for those with a knack for mechanics. These professionals are the ultimate problem-solvers when it comes to industrial machinery. Their work involves installing, dismantling, repairing, and maintaining complex mechanical equipment, often using precision tools and advanced diagnostic techniques. Whether it’s a massive conveyor system, a precision robotic arm, or a production line, a millwright ensures everything is perfectly aligned and fully operational. The demand for millwright work is consistently high, especially for those with a 433a millwright certification, indicating a comprehensive skill set in industrial mechanic millwright 433a practices. Welding and Fabrication Specialists

Welding trades are crucial across countless industries, including construction, manufacturing, automotive, and marine. A skilled welder is a true artisan, capable of joining metals with precision, creating strong and durable structures. Their expertise is essential for everything from fabricating structural steelwork and pressure vessels to repairing pipelines and assembling complex machinery. Given the safety-critical nature of welding, certified professionals are always in high demand. Q: Are there federal skilled trades programs for immigrants in the UK?

A: The UK has specific immigration routes for skilled workers, and skilled trades are often a key part of this. While the specific terminology “federal skilled trades program” is typically associated with Canada, the UK equivalent involves routes like the Skilled Worker visa, which allows eligible skilled trades professionals to come to the UK for work. We can provide general guidance and point you to official government resources for the most up-to-date immigration information.
